Egis teams up with Saudi airport-tech firm
15 November 2023
Nera was set up to provide technical consulting to the aviation sector.
The pair will develop a list of projects to collaborate on.
Egis noted that Saudi Arabia’s tourism strategy aims to attract 100 million visitors by 2030.
“A high-performing aviation sector will be key to achieving these ambitions, and this means collaborating and innovating,” said Thanos Deriziotis, Egis’ aviation director for the Middle East and South Asia.
Egis is currently providing services to airports in Riyadh, Dammam, Jeddah, AlUla, and Amaala, and has also recently signed a three-year contract with Matarat to provide consulting services to 26 airports around Saudi Arabia.
